Reseña del libro "Steep Trails (en Inglés)"

In "Steep Trails," John Muir invites readers to journey through the sublime landscapes of the Sierra Nevada, blending vivid descriptions of nature with reflective essays on humanity's relationship with the environment. The text showcases Muir's lyrical prose and deep appreciation for the wilderness, echoing the Romantic era's celebration of nature while simultaneously addressing the emerging conservation movement of the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Muir's intimate observations and passionate advocacy illuminate the intrinsic beauty of the mountains, as well as the pressing need for their preservation, positioning the work as a cornerstone of American nature writing. John Muir, often dubbed the 'Father of the National Parks,' spent decades exploring the natural wonders of North America, which profoundly shaped his worldview. His experiences as a botanist, glaciologist, and outspoken environmentalist informed his writings, encouraging a profound respect for natural landscapes. Muir's dedication to the preservation of wilderness areas led to significant environmental legislation, exemplifying his role not only as a writer but also as a crucial figure in America's conservation history. "Steep Trails" is a must-read for nature enthusiasts, environmental advocates, and lovers of American literature. Muir's evocative storytelling not only immerses readers in breathtaking vistas but also compels them to reflect on their own connection to the earth. This classic text remains a vital commentary on environmental stewardship and the enduring beauty of wild places.
